Structure of the Driving License Exam
The driving license test usually includes 2 main components: the composed test and the practical driving test.
1. Written Test
The written component assesses a candidate's understanding of road rules, traffic signs, and safe driving practices. It often includes multiple-choice questions and true/false questions, covering topics such as:
Road indications and their significancesTraffic laws and policiesSafe driving techniquesTreatments for dealing with emergenciesRights and obligations of motorists
Prospects are normally needed to study the local driver's manual, which describes the relevant laws and standards for safe driving.
2. Practical Driving Test
Following an effective written examination, prospects must complete a practical driving test. This hands-on evaluation determines a candidate's capability to run a lorry and comply with traffic policies in real-world conditions. Secret aspects of the useful test consist of:
Vehicle control and managingComplying with traffic signals and signsNavigating intersections and turnsCorrect usage of mirrors and signal lightsParking techniques (parallel, perpendicular, etc)Responding to pedestrian and cyclist existence
Both elements are crucial for getting a driving license, and sufficient preparation is vital for success.
Requirements to Take the Driving License Exam
Requirements for taking the driving license exam vary by jurisdiction, however there are common requirements that many candidates must fulfill:
Age Requirement: Most jurisdictions require prospects to be a minimum of 16 years of ages, although some may allow earlier screening with adult consent.Student's Permit: Many areas require prospects to get a student's license before taking the driving test. This permit allows people to practice driving under adult supervision.Documentation: Candidates should offer valid recognition, evidence of residency, and, in some cases, paperwork of completed motorist education courses.Practice Hours: Some jurisdictions mandate a minimum number of practice hours behind the wheel before being qualified for the driving test.Getting ready for the Driving License Exam

A: Candidates need to bring valid identification, their learner's authorization, any required documents (like proof of residency), and a properly kept lorry that satisfies all security requirements.
Q: How do I understand if I passed my driving test?
A: After completing the useful driving test, the inspector will typically offer immediate feedback. If you pass, you will receive details on how to acquire your motorist's license. If you stop working, the examiner will use insights on locations requiring enhancement and how to retest.
Q: How frequently can I retake the driving test if I stop working?
A: The retake policy differs by area. Some areas might permit candidates to retake the test as quickly as the following day, while others might impose a waiting duration of a number of weeks. It is very important to inspect with the local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or equivalent authority for particular policies.
